Alexander specialises in banking and finance, advising on matters of both Jersey and British Virgin Islands law.
Although he regularly acts for conventional lending institutions, Alexander specialises in cross-border Islamic financing transactions which involve offshore entities structured in a Shariah-compliant manner. He has acted for Islamic banks and financial institutions, in both the UK and the Middle East, for over nine years and is familiar with a range of Shariah-compliant products.
Alexander also acts for investors (both individuals and institutional) looking to obtain financing, and structure their investments, through offshore entities.
Prior to moving offshore in August 2018, Alexander worked in the real estate finance team at Shakespeare Martineau LLP in Birmingham. Alex was promoted to Senior Associate in January 2023.
He is ranked as a Leading Associate in Legal 500.
Alexander is an active member of the Arab Bankers' Association.
*admitted in England and Wales, and British Virgin Islands

Fund financing covers a range of financing possibilities but most commonly involves capital call or subscription facilities. It is a specialist area that requires an understanding of fund structuring, the risks involved in lending to funds and specific security requirements.
